Abstract
In wireless sensor network (WSN), much literature focuses on developing energy-efficient protocols. In addition, many papers propose data storage schemes but they do not take power saving into consideration. Hence, these data storage schemes cannot perform well based on energy-efficient protocols. Therefore, it is very critical to propose a data storage scheme to support energy-efficient mechanism. In this paper, we propose an energy-efficient data storage scheme in WSN. Our scheme adopts a grid-base architecture, in which each grid guarantees that two sensors will stay in active mode while the other sensors stay in sleep mode to save energy. Simulations have shown that our energy-efficient data storage scheme can reduce energy consumption.
